There+are+4+tablespoons+in+1/4+cup+there+are+2+cups+in+1+pint+How+many+tablespoons+are+in+1+pint
qaws [65]

Answer:

32 tablespoons are in 1 pint

Step-by-step explanation:

1/4 cup = 4 tablespoons

2/4 = 8 tablespoons

3/4 = 12 tablespoons

4/4 (1 cup) = 16 tablespoons

16*2 = 32

1 pint = 2 cups = 32 tablespoons
